    The Marshall Mathers LP is Eminem's Magnum Opus. It still captures his Slim Shady persona from the previous album, but this time he is at his lyrical peak. Throughout the album he addresses his rise to fame and the controversy that came with it, but he also goes back to his Shady antics and raps about drugs and killing women (including his wife).
